An interesting point in V8 is that the data and pointers are not in the same spaces. It would mean in Cog, if I understand correctly, that byte and word objects are not in the same space as other objects. I guess this simplifies the GC logic. I don't know if they did that in VW.
I have a general question regarding VM. Are you aware of other Virtual machines supporting this? Does the Java VM support fragmented memory? .Net? V8?
Any VM that uses the train algorithm supports segmented memory. Any VM that uses "pools" or "regions" uses segmented memory. VisualWorks' VM supports segments. I'm pretty sure that V8 .Net & HotSpot provide segmented memory.

A very general reference could be the Garbage Collection Handbook (Jones, Hosking, Moss) chapter 8 and 10: Partitioning the heap 8.1 Terminology 8.2 Why to partition Partitioning by mobility Partitioning by size Partitioning for space Partitioning by kind Partitioning for yield Partitioning to reduce pause time Partitioning for locality Partitioning by thread Partitioning by availability Partitioning by mutability 8.3 How to partition 8.4 When to partition Chapter 10 elaborates on large objects and pointer-free objects (as well as algorithms that use partitioning).
